Output 1bbf563697abc845045f8fb6d7bf23db3ff8728e44320fb155fc96e5dfcf32d7:2

value
517635
script pubkey
OP_0 OP_PUSHBYTES_20 5699b1ffd1a99ce3b803abaea0589bf67875bbe1
address
bc1q26vmrl734xww8wqr4wh2qkym7eu8twlp66n0r5
transaction
1bbf563697abc845045f8fb6d7bf23db3ff8728e44320fb155fc96e5dfcf32d7
confirmations
44701
spent
true